Involution Matrices of Real Quaternions

An involution or anti-involution is a self-inverse linear mapping. In this paper, we will present two real quaternion matrices, one corresponding to a real quaternion involution and one corresponding to a real quaternion anti-involution. Moreover, properties and geometrical meanings of these matrices will be given as reflections in R^3.

Lorentz Transformations

In these notes we study Lorentz transformations and focus on the group of proper, orthochronous Lorentz transformations, donated by L+. (These Lorentz transformations have determinant one and preserve the direction of time.)
